Despite Injury Concerns, Former Champions Djokovic and Murray Enter Wimbledon

After some anxious days, Wimbledon officials got the news they were hoping for when seven-time men’s singles champion Novak Djokovic, as well as Andy Murray, confirmed that they intend to play in the tournament despite dealing with injuries. Neither of them headline the 2024 Wimbledon Men’s outright odds.

Top-seeded Jannik Sinner and defending champions Carlos Alcaraz are the players to beat.

Sinner and Alcaraz could meet in the semifinals with Djokovic and Andrey Rublev on a possible collision course in the semifinals.

Sinner is sure to draw plenty of tennis betting action at +160 to win his first Wimbledon title despite a challenging draw. Alcaraz isn’t far behind at +175 as he looks to join Djokovic, Roger Federer, Pete Sampras, Boris Becker, John McEnroe, and Bjorn Borg as men’s players in the last 50 years to win back-to-back Gentlemen’s Singles titles at Wimbledon.

Can Sinner Break Through?

Sinner won his first career Grand Slam earlier this year when he topped Djokovic in the semifinals and then rallied past Daniil Medvedev in five sets in the Australian Open final.

Sinner has been inching closer to winning Wimbledon as he lost in the first round in 2021, got to the 2022 quarterfinals, and advanced to the 2023 semifinals.

Tallon Griekspoor could be the first-seeded player he could see.

No. 5 seed Daniil Medvedev could be waiting in the quarterfinals while No. 10 Grigor Dimitrov and American Ben Shelton are other seeded players to keep an eye on in this portion of the draw.

  • Medvedev is a little undervalued at +1600 in the 2024 Wimbledon Men’s outright odds. Dimitrov is priced at +2500 at Wimbledon.

Alcaraz Eyeing Another Wimbledon Run

A third-round showdown between Alcaraz and talented American Frances Tiafoe is sure to make plenty of news in the first week of Wimbledon.

Casper Ruud is a possible quarterfinal opponent. However, Ruud has never advanced past the second round in his four appearances in the main draw at Wimbledon. There are 16 players with shorter odds to win Wimbledon than Ruud who is currently at +6600 in the 2024 Wimbledon Men’s Outright odds.

If Ruud stumbles again, that could open the door for American Tommy Paul. Paul is coming off a win at the Queens Club Championships. It was his first ATP singles title on grass.

Ugo Humbert and Sebastian Baez are other seeded players that Alcaraz might have to contend with as he looks to reach his sixth straight quarterfinal at a Grand Slam.

Can Djokovic Return to the Top?

Djokovic’s bid to win a record-tying eighth Wimbledon title ended when Alcaraz won 6-4 in the fifth set in the 2023 singles final. Djokovic, Rafael Nadal, Roger Federer, and Andy Murray had combined to win the last 19 Wimbledon titles.

Federer is retired, Nadal is not in this year’s Wimbledon, and Murray is nearing retirement. That leaves Djokovic as the last of the Big 4 as a title contender at Wimbledon. He is the No. 3 favorite at +400.

Djokovic hasn’t played since a knee injury kept him from taking the court against Casper Ruud in the quarterfinals of the French Open. There were concerns about Djokovic’s availability for this tournament.

It would be incredible theater if Djokovic and Murray were to meet in the quarterfinals. However, Murray might need to get through Francisco Cerundolo and Hubert Hurkacz to make that happen. Hurkacz has +1500 odds to win the title.

  • Alex de Minaur (+2000), Holger Rune (+4000), Felix Auger-Aliassime (+8000), Karen Khachanov, and Tomas Martin Echeverry are other seeded players in a stacked draw as Djokovic could have his work cut out for him.

Can Fritz Make a Run?

No U.S. player has won the Wimbledon Gentlemen’s Singles title since Pete Sampras in 2000 and it is not looking promising for that to change in 2024.

Taylor Fritz has the shortest odds of +3300 among the U.S. hopefuls at +3300 followed by Sebastian Korda (+4000), Tommy Paul (+4000), and Ben Shelton (+6600). He is the only one of those players who has advanced to the quarterfinals at Wimbledon.

Fritz has a reasonable draw beginning with Christopher O’Connell in the first round. A potential match in the third round against No. 11 Stefanos Tsitsipas won’t be easy. The draw also includes British hopefuls Jack Draper and Cameron Norrie.

There has been plenty of early money coming in on Draper as he is now at +2000 in the 2024 Wimbledon Men’s outright odds.
